Welcome to the eleventh Professional Broking Sentiment Survey - the industry barometer tracking the issues facing brokers. In addition to our regular round-up of regulation, service and the market cycle issues, views on insurers buying brokers were mixed, with 40% prepared to sell to an insurer, but the majority criticised the approach, saying brokers will not remain independently managed under such arrangements

Yet again, the Professional Broking sentiment survey offers a fascinating insight into the way that UK brokers are thinking, and a valuable snapshot of the issues that are keeping them awake at night.
